About:Xue is a second year Ph.D. student in the Department of Computer Science at the University of Rochester. Her research work focuses on humanoid motor control. | |
Research Interests:My research interests include motor control, robotics, machine learning, computational neuroscience. Currently, I am working on humanoid motor control using the concepts of motor primitives. There are evidence from neuroscience that motor primitives exists in natural animals, and those primitives can be adaptively combined into complex behaviors. How does human being encode motor commands in the brain? How is movements controlled in the motor contex? How can the machanisms human being uses be applied to robotics to build up dexterous, adaptive and flexible agents? These are the questions that I am wondering in my research. | |
